Clinic definition

Clinic means a facility that provides hemodialysis or peritoneal dialysis services to patients suffering from kidney disease.
Clinic means an indigent health care clinic as defined by K.S.A. 75-6102 and amendments thereto.

More Definitions of Clinic

Clinic means a place, other than a residence, that is used primarily for the provision of nursing, medical, podiatric, dental, chiropractic, optometric or veterinary care and treatment.
Clinic means any of the facilities, including ------ satellite facilities, that Service Company shall own, lease or otherwise procure and provide for the use of Provider.
Clinic s Physician Contracts” means all agreements to provide the services of a Physician to a Clinic, regardless of whether any of the agreements are with a Physician or with a medical group, including, but not limited to, agreements for the services of a medical director for the Clinic and “joinder” agreements with Physicians in the same medical practice as a medical director of the Clinic.
Clinic means a facility that is organized and operated independent of any institution to furnish preventive, diagnostic, therapeutic, rehabilitative, or palliative Medicaid care, goods, or services to outpatients.
